About

Jacqueline Litoff is a Licensed Mental Health Counselor (LMHC) who holds a Master’s Degree in Creative Arts Therapy Counseling from Hofstra University. Her graduate training emphasized multidisciplinary, inclusive care, which informs an eclectic style designed to meet each client’s needs with flexibility and intention.

She has worked in treatment settings supporting adults, adolescents, and coming of age individuals navigating mental health concerns and substance use challenges. Jacqueline approaches therapy with the understanding that every person arrives with a unique story and their own ways of coping, and she tailors sessions to meet clients where they are while helping them discover new perspectives and possibilities.

Her work may incorporate creative and body-based options such as art therapy, sandtray, and somatic methods, alongside structured, skills-focused approaches like CBT, DBT, motivational interviewing, Gestalt therapy, and solution-focused strategies. By drawing from a wide range of evidence-based therapeutic techniques, she aims to support each client’s direction and goals while opening space for growth, insight, and meaningful change.

Jacqueline’s goal is to foster a supportive environment that encourages self-exploration and personal development. She focuses on expanding perspective, strengthening sense of self, and building insight in ways that can guide clients toward hope, action, and steps toward healing.

Evidence-Based Techniques, Creative Tools, and Online Flexibility

Jacqueline Litoff integrates evidence-based therapeutic techniques with creative, experiential options to support growth in a way that fits each client. CBT (cognitive behavioral therapy) focuses on how thoughts, feelings, and behaviors interact, helping clients build practical skills for challenges like stress, anxiety, depression, and self-esteem concerns. DBT (dialectical behavior therapy) adds structured strategies for emotion regulation, distress tolerance, and interpersonal effectiveness, which can be especially helpful when feelings feel intense or hard to manage.

She may also draw from creative arts therapy elements, such as art-based exercises, to help clients express experiences that can be difficult to put into words. For some people, these tools can support reflection, insight, and processing around relationships, trauma and abuse, guilt and shame, or life transitions.

Finding the right approach is part of the work. Jacqueline collaborates with clients to clarify goals and preferences, then adjusts the pace and methods over time so therapy feels relevant and supportive.
